(a) In IV-D cases in which an obligor is subject to income withholding for court ordered child support payments, health care coverage and any arrearages, and the amount of withholding allowed by law does not satisfy all withholding orders against the obligor, payment of current child support obligations shall be given priority in accordance with W.S. 20-6-215. (b) After the requirements of W.S. 20-6-215 are met, health insurance premiums shall be prioritized by the court or tribunal on a case-by-case basis.
